WebThe process of determining the value of the individual forces acting upon an object involve an application of Newton's second law (F net =m•a) and an application of the meaning of the net force. If mass (m) and acceleration (a) are known, then the net force (F net) can be determined by use of the equation. F net = m • a.

WebFeb 19, 2004 · So for your linear motion, you start out with an initial velocity v and you have a force = mu * N acting in the direction opposite v. N is your normal force = mass * g. You will need to know your mass and gravity, or perhaps mu is a force in your case. Basically its the same problem as a block stopping due to friction. WebThe force of static friction F s F_s F s F, start subscript, s, end subscript is a force between two surfaces that prevents those surfaces from sliding or slipping across each other.
